#132183 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#132183 is composed of 7.5% red, 12.9%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 74.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 232.5 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 29.4%. #132183 color hex could be obtained by blending #2642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#132183
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030b is the darkest color, while #f9f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#132183
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#47484f is the less saturated color, while #021494 is the most saturated one.
